Join us for a riveting session where we pull back the curtain on the intricacies of leadership and entrepreneurship with the company of fitness moguls Russ and Shawdog. We shed light on the complexities of guiding a team beyond the realm of example-setting and into the trenches of active management. Listen in as we traverse the challenges of business ownership, from the tough decisions that shape the course of a company to the emotional toll it takes on those at the helm. We don't shy away from the candid confessions of our struggles, embracing the often solitary path of a CEO and the seismic shifts in career paths, like the pivot from gym ownership to the digital spotlight of influencing.
This episode is also a heart-to-heart exchange, as we touch on personal matters ranging from health scares to the quirks of our friendships. Discover the lighter side of our dynamic as we banter about the peculiarities of personal hygiene preferences and navigate the social intricacies of modern dating. We emphasize the importance of mental well-being, sharing anecdotes that underscore the need for genuine connection beyond professional interactions. Plus, get ready for some playful debates that blur the lines between anime and cartoons, dissect the nuances of the superhero genre, and challenge the status quo of the music industry.
